When I started playing a month ago, I really didn't have any trouble finding groups to do quests with, usually someone would say "LFF Questname", I'd reply, and they'd add me to the group. Or sometimes we'd run into each other while during the quest and join up there.
Recently, since I'be been in my upper teens and low twenties, I mostly seem to be ignored when I reply to LFF request. And when I use LFF myself, it doesn't really draw a response (except the occasional, "You get anyone for _____"?).
Any tips? Is it my class (Champion, admittedly not the most desired)? I was frustrated today and switched to an alt for a while (A Guardian) and didn't have problem finding a group for a lower level quest. (And note I play on Landroval, not the most popular server, but #3 apparently)

Instead of saying "LFF for "quest name" say something like "I"M putting together a group for "x".
I bet there are players out there who are not much into putting groups together but they would join if someone were to do the "putting together". You could be that person. Another thought is that if someone is yelling to fill out a team for another quest, tell them you will help but you would like them to help with your quest. That might also work.

Also don't set yourself anonymous. There's little reason to these days, the spam filter catches most of the spam tells. I see (at least on my server) a LOT of people flat out won't invite anonymous people to their groups.
Also see if your server has a popular global LFF user channel you can join. My server has GLFF and I think several other servers use that same channel name. Try /joinchannel GLFF otherwise check your official server forums. Sometimes I get groups easier from GLFF since people not in my current zone might see it and want to help. Don't skip the normal LFF either, since the majority of players don't read forums and therefore may not know about popular user channels.
